Understanding the Types of Driving Licenses in the UK
Before diving into the procedure of getting a driving license online, it's necessary to understand the types of licenses available in the UK:
Provisional Driving License: This is the initial step for brand-new drivers. A provisionary license permits people to discover to drive under guidance and works after an application has actually been approved.
Full Driving License: After passing the driving test, a provisional license can be transformed into a complete driving license, permitting individuals to drive independently.
Special Licenses: These include licenses for particular car categories such as bikes, buses, and lorries.
Eligibility Requirements
Specific eligibility requirements must be satisfied before one can apply for a UK driving license online. These consist of:

The procedure of obtaining a UK driving license online is straightforward. Here's a step-by-step guide:
Step 1: Prepare Required Documents
Before beginning the application, gather the required files, including:
Your present passport or an alternative kind of identity.Your National Insurance number.Your address history for the previous three years.Any medical details that may be relevant.Action 2: Visit the Official DVLA Website
The Driver and Vehicle Licensing Agency (DVLA) is the main federal government body responsible for driver licensing in the UK. Applicants must constantly begin at the DVLA's official site to guarantee they are accessing legitimate services.
Step 3: Complete the Online Application
When on the DVLA website, pick the option to obtain a driving license. Complete the online kind with accurate info referring to your identity, address, and any extra concerns.
Step 4: Pay the Application Fee
An application charge is needed to process your license request. Payments can be made online by means of debit or charge card. Since the most recent guidelines, the fee for a provisionary license is typically around ₤ 34.
Step 5: Submit Your Application
After finishing the type and making the payment, review all details for accuracy, then submit your application.
Action 6: Wait for Your License
Once sent, the DVLA will process your application. For provisionary licenses, processing generally takes about 3 weeks. Full driving licenses might take longer, especially if dry runs are included.
